Another thought would be to hook up on 2m Williamsport repeater which is about half way between us. Repeater frequency is 145.330- tone 167.9 or 146.730- no tone. Also one in Berwick which is a linked repeater frequency 145.130- tone 77.0 all of these I can get into.

looks similar to an R390/U... We learned about them in 1969 A school Treasure Island SF...still had one on board the Richard S Edwards DD 950 in 1974... These had a lot of silver contacts and were a very sensitive receiver... With good tubes, better than any transistorized receiver today!
After looking it up I see my memory is failing... But the unit still looks very familiar... Perhaps it is an oscillator or signal generator... At any rate the old gear could perform very well!
